DevnullMod 1.71.0 Released!

Submitted by devnullicus on Thu, 2008-03-27 23:49. Space Empires V General

DevnullMod 1.71.0 is released. Lots of tweaks and changes as well as being updated for SE5 v1.71. Changes:

================================================================
Version 1.71.0
================================================================
1.  Changed  Integrated Dvoongar's Doctrines 0.94
2.  Changed  Integrated changes from Balance Mod 1.14a
             -AI scripts
3.  Changed  Damage Types "Only Weapons", "Only Engines", and "Only Shield Generators" now bypass armor and shields (as per SE5 v1.71)

Ground Combat Mod 2.14

Submitted by Brad on Fri, 2008-03-28 17:43. SE:V MODs

Hardly worth an update really, since all I did was update the data files to SEV 1.71. But I took the opportunity to change the download from a .zip to a .rar which cut nearly 700kb off the file size. New download here!

If you don't want to download the whole thing again for such a piddly change, just delete the Mainstrings.txt and RacialTraits.txt from the mod's Data folder. There were a couple of other changes but doing this will allow the mod to run under 1.71.
